Red Island House by Andrea Lee

Here’s what  about : “Lee’s seductive novel (her first in 15 years, after ) chronicles the life of Shay Gilliam, a Black American woman married to an Italian man. Her husband, Senna, builds the couple a vacation property and pension in northwestern Madagascar.
